Output 3c87c308395349b15a7aa6b133bb568aad4a38c2f15404a1165654f39a588557:0

value
9900979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59df8dbace8c5535f6455397c716093e60e2ee62 OP_EQUALVERIFY OP_CHECKSIG
address
19CCwrPbk6amZRMBEQ4BWjxDNHaWUdRnzN
transaction
3c87c308395349b15a7aa6b133bb568aad4a38c2f15404a1165654f39a588557
spent
true